1. Resume Summary

Your resume summary is the snapshot that grabs the recruiter’s interest within seconds. As a project supervisor, it should succinctly convey your years of experience, leadership style, key skills, and notable accomplishments.

Example: “Results-oriented Project Supervisor with over 8 years of experience managing cross-functional teams and delivering complex projects on time and within budget. Proven track record of optimizing workflows, improving team productivity by 25%, and reducing project delivery times by 15% through Agile methodologies.”

3. Achievements

Focusing on achievements rather than just listing responsibilities makes your resume compelling. Use metrics to quantify your impact and demonstrate your contributions.

For instance, instead of “Managed project teams,” write “Led a 12-member team to deliver a $2M infrastructure upgrade, completing the project 10% ahead of schedule and 8% under budget.”

4. Tailor to Job

Each job application deserves a customized resume that aligns your skills and experiences with the specific job description. Analyze the keywords and required qualifications in the job posting, and integrate these naturally into your resume. This improves your ATS ranking and shows recruiters you meet their needs precisely.

9. Concise

Keep your resume to two pages maximum, focusing on the most relevant details. Avoid jargon and superfluous words; clear and direct language works best.

10. Bonus

  • Include a section for professional development or training courses related to project management
  • Leverage action verbs like "spearheaded," "optimized," and "facilitated" to create dynamic descriptions

Examples

  • “Spearheaded a cross-departmental collaboration that cut approval cycles by 30%, accelerating project launch timelines.”
  • “Optimized resource allocation across five simultaneous projects, resulting in a 20% reduction in overhead costs.”
